Bailey Ruskus, a classically trained French chef turned plant-based advocate, drops some eye-opening truths about the dairy industry. She shares her personal journey overcoming autoimmune disease through diet, and highlights the health risks tied to dairy, including inflammation and cancer. Ruskus also discusses the environmental toll of factory farming and the political lobbies keeping dairy staples on our plates. Plus, she offers insights on how to transition away from dairy without sacrificing flavor—perfect for anyone considering cutting it out!

Bailey Ruskus's "Breaking Up With Dairy" offers a comprehensive guide to dairy-free cooking, featuring 100 recipes for milks, cheeses, sauces, and desserts. The book addresses common food allergies and provides alternatives for various dietary restrictions. It's designed to be accessible to all skill levels, with recipes ranging from simple to more complex. The author shares her personal journey of transitioning to a dairy-free lifestyle, offering psychological insights into dairy addiction. The book aims to empower readers to make conscious food choices and enjoy delicious, healthy meals.
Is dairy really as good for you as they say? Or is it time to break up with it for good?
In this episode of Super Life, Darin Olien sits down with Bailey Ruskus, also known as Chef Bai, to uncover the hidden truths about the dairy industry and why so many people struggle to give it up. They dive into the health risks of dairy, the environmental damage of factory farming, and the political influence of the dairy industry that keeps it on our plates.
Bailey shares her personal journey from a classically trained French chef to a plant-based advocate, how she overcame autoimmune disease and chronic pain, and why she wrote Breaking Up with Dairy to help others take back their health.
If you’ve ever wondered why dairy is everywhere, why it’s so addictive, or how to transition away from it without missing out on flavor—this episode is for you!
